Bitcoin ETF Daily Flow Shows Zero Movement for Franklin

Bitcoin ETF Daily Flow Shows Zero Movement for Franklin

According to Farside Investors, the Bitcoin ETF daily flow report shows that Franklin's US dollar flow remains at 0 million. This indicates no new investment inflow or outflow for this particular ETF, which could suggest a period of stability or stagnation in investor sentiment. Such data is crucial for traders as it may influence short-term trading strategies, particularly in relation to assessing market liquidity and investor confidence.
